What do you mean by segregation of Biomedical wase segregation?

Segregation of biomedical waste refers to the practice of separating different types of biomedical waste at the point of origin to ensure safe handling, treatment, and disposal. It typically involves categorizing waste into distinct groups, such as hazardous, infectious, non-hazardous, and recyclable materials, to minimize risks to health and the environment. Proper segregation enhances the efficiency of waste management processes and reduces the potential for contamination or exposure to harmful substances. This practice is crucial in healthcare settings to protect both public health and the environment.

How can waste segregation help?

Waste segregation helps by ensuring that different types of waste are properly separated at the source, which facilitates recycling and composting. This reduces the amount of waste sent to landfills and minimizes environmental pollution. Additionally, it promotes efficient resource recovery, conserving natural resources and energy. Ultimately, waste segregation fosters greater public awareness and responsibility regarding waste management.

What is the beneficial effects of waste segregation?

Waste segregation helps to reduce the volume of waste sent to landfills, promotes recycling and composting, minimizes environmental pollution, conserves resources, and reduces greenhouse gas emissions.
